Comprehensive data protection and reliable backup capabilities enable smooth disaster recovery operations
The features of Quest NetVault Plus ( /products/quest-netvault-plus-reviews ) that are most valuable include the ability to pick up and restore to tape servers and external hard disks. It allows us to pick up from devices and then restore to the same devices or external server storage. Additionally, the application supports scanning files for malware before backup operations.

"Overall, its cost is better because the VMs are already there, and whatever you back up, there is only the additional cost of that storage, whereas if I have to use Avamar in Azure, a separate cost is there for the Avamar server, and in addition, whatever I take as a backup, there is a separate license with Avamar for that. So, there is a double cost if we have to use Avamar in the cloud."
